The Fallout 4 Pip-Boy Edition is the game's only official collector's version, coming in a unique Power Armor collectible metal packaging which contains a copy of Fallout 4, a Pip-Boy pocket guide, a Vault-Tec perk poster, and a wearable Pip-Boy replica with a stand and capsule case.

The Pip-Boy replica allows gamers to place their smartphones in it, and once the Pip-Boy app is turned on in the smartphone, gamers can use the replica like the game's character. The app allows gamers to monitor the stats of their character, as well as check out quests, the game's map and more.
